The American Language Course Placement Test (ALCPT) is a critical assessment tool used globally by defense and government agencies to measure the English language proficiency of non-native speakers. Within the testing community, specific test versions known as "Forms" are released to maintain security and accuracy. ALCPT Form 91 represents one of the advanced iterations in this testing series.
